Funding Options
Coaching and consulting are not medical services and are not covered by medical insurance. We are not contracted with Medicare, Medicaid or other major medical insurance provider.
Funding may be available to you through your employer, especially if they offer support for employees with disabilities. US Government employees in particular are likely to be able to get a certain amount of job coaching paid for through disability support programs.
You may also have access to a variety of local support programs able to provide grants for life coaching or consulting. We are not aware of what programs may be available in your particular location, but do encourage you to see what you can find and suggest you contact them regarding their policies.
Some large employers offer job coaching as part of their employee benefits, particularly to management level employees. You can ask about job coaching benefits without mentioning Asperger Syndrome if you have not disclosed your diagnosis (or have not gotten a diagnosis).
